MS Access和SQL

Anonim

MS Access与SQL

Microsoft Office Access(或简称为MS Access)是Microsoft创建的关系数据库管理系统。它将关系型Microsoft Jet数据库引擎与GUI和软件开发工具结合在一起。它也是各种应用程序(包括MS Word,MS Excel和MS PowerPoint)的Microsoft Office套件的一部分。 MS Access基于Access Jet数据库引擎以特定于Access的格式存储数据。它还能够导入或链接存储在其他Access数据库,Excel,SharePoint,列表,文本,XML,Outlook,HTML,dBase,Paradox,Lotus 1-2-3或任何符合ODBC的数据容器中的数据。 (例如,Microsoft SQL Server)直接。

结构化查询语言(也称为SQL)是一种数据库语言。它专门用于管理RDMS中的数据,其概念基于关系代数。其功能范围包括数据查询和更新,模式创建和修改以及数据访问控制。它是使用RDMS模型的第一批语言之一,并且肯定是这些关系数据库中使用最广泛的语言。 SQL语言被细分为多个语言元素:子句,它们有时是语句和查询的可选组成部分;表达式,它产生标量值或由数据列和行组成的表;谓词,用于指定能够评估为SQL三值逻辑(或3VL)布尔值的条件;查询,根据特定规范检索数据;和语句,它们会影响模式和数据,或者还可以控制事务,程序流,连接,会话或诊断。

Access主要用作创建简单数据库解决方案的手段。通过Access创建的表支持过多的标准字段类型,索引和参照完整性。它还配有一个查询界面,一个可以显示和输入数据的表单,以及用于打印的报表。通过使用点击选项,Access允许用户通过宏自动执行简单任务。它非常受非程序员的欢迎,他们能够创造视觉上令人愉悦且相当先进的解决方案。

SQL现在是一个标准,它的结构由许多不同的组件组成。这些包括但不限于SQL Framework,SQL / Foundation,SQL / Bindings,SQL / CLI(调用级接口)和SQL / XML(或XML相关规范)。

摘要:

1. Access是一种关系数据库管理系统,它以基于Access Jet数据库引擎的格式存储数据; SQL是专门用于管理RDMS中数据的数据库语言。

2.访问主要用于创建简单的数据库解决方案; SQL是由多个组件组成的标准,包括但不限于SQL Framework,SQL / CLI和SQL / XML。